‘The Night Agent’ Season 3: Release Date, Cast, Plot, and All We Know So Far

Netflix‘s users made The Night Agent their most-watched series of 2023. Gabriel Basso stars in the series as Peter Sutherland, which shows political conspiracies to viewers worldwide and ranks number one on Netflix’s Top 10 lists across 87 countries.

After the premiere of Season 2 in January 2025, fans are also excited about the early decision to make Season 3. The series adapted from Matthew Quirk’s novel remains popular with subscribers, as it ended up being number 7 in Netflix’s all-time most-watched English series. Viewers continue to hang on every word from creator Shawn Ryan as Season 3 promises more action.

Cast and creative team of The Night Agent Season 3

Season 3 of The Night Agent welcomes new actors to join its accomplished cast. Gabriel Basso will continue as Peter Sutherland. Season 3 welcomes David Lyons, Jennifer Morrison, Stephen Moyer, Genesis Rodriguez, and Callum Vinson to join its permanent cast roster. Among new talent, the show welcomes Suraj Sharma to its cast in a recurring role.

The core creative team delivers remarkable work throughout the series production process. As MiddKid Productions’ head, Shawn Ryan remains involved by leading production as executive producer and showrunner. The list of executive producers also includes Marney Hochman from MiddKid Productions, along with Seth Gordon and Julia Gunn from Exhibit A.

James Vanderbilt joins Paul Neinstein, William Sherak, and Nicole Tossou from Project X. Finally, Munis Rashid, Paul Bernard, Guy Ferland, and Seth Fisher complete the production team.

Production timeline and potential release window of The Night Agent season 3

Filming of Season 3 of The Night Agent began in Istanbul, with the team scheduled to return to New York for filming in 2025. The beginning of production on Season 3 happened way ahead of the premiere of Season 2, indicating Netflix’s confidence and perhaps an attempt on their part to move things along for the series to bring it to some further endpoints.

Looking at the way the show has been produced so far, a release date for Season 3 looks possible during late 2025 or early 2026. However, there could be other unseen factors, such as the programming schedule combined with the post-production requirements, that might impact the exact release date.

The production team chose Istanbul as a filming location to potentially show the audiences that The Night Agent now reaches an international audience. An Istanbul setting will introduce exciting layout styles, new plotlines, and a more international scope for Season 3.

What might happen in The Night Agent Season 3?

Shawn Ryan says Season 2 will start building the plot for Season 3. Each new season creates a standalone narrative, though Season 2’s plot elements will continue into Season 3. Gabriel Basso reveals in recent interviews that Peter Sutherland’s actions in Season 2 will produce major plot developments for his character in Season 3.

In Season 2, Sutherland, as a night agent, looks into a CIA security issue and a potential terror threat in New York City. Moreover, the showrunner plans to include important moments from the presidential election season, and Season 3 will evolve based on its ripple effects. Speaking to TV Line, Ryan said,

Each season is a different story for us, a different world, but there will be some loose ends in Season 2 that we intend to pick up in Season 3. But we always try to tell a really satisfying story each season and not leave the audience frustrated waiting a year for a lot of answers. Most of Season 2’s questions get answered by the end of our 10 episodes and these 10 episodes tell a complete (and we hope) thrilling story.

In Season 1, Rose Larkin, played by Luciane Buchanan, gets some sort of closure, but in Season 2, her story takes a different path. Amanda Warren’s character Catherine Weaver will also be important during Season 3, as Warren said in her TV line interview that she is “going to get what she needs, and following her in that pursuit is really exciting.”

In addition to this, her actions will further lead to what is coming next in the show. During his interview with TV Line, Gabriel Basso hints at additional tension for Sutherland in Season 3.

It carries and snowballs. Every decision Peter makes in Season 2 will have an effect for Season 3. Having been shooting it now, I can tell you that he is in a tight spot.

It, therefore, seems that his choices in Season 2 will have repercussions that might lead to new ideas for Season 3. As production has already started, The Night Agent Season 3 seems promising to hold on to its reputation as one of the most-watched series on Netflix.
